Finding a Good Used Vehicle for New Drivers

Shopping for a good used vehicle is almost like going on a treasure hunt -- the pathway is often arduous, but the reward in the end is worth it. If you are looking to navigate the used vehicle market for a new driver, we are here to arm you with some helpful tips and tricks: 

  1. Set your budget and stick to it! The first step is to narrow down what you are looking for. The used car industry is full of options, so it is smart to go in with an idea of what you are looking for. 
  2. Choose the right car for your new driver. Figure out what your new driver is looking for. For example, beginning drivers may need a car equipped with safety features, or perhaps a roomy trunk for your son’s football gear. 
  3. Make sure the car you are looking at has a history of reliability and dependability. 
  4. Browse online, looking at reputable websites, for good used cars. 
  5. If you find a vehicle, use a pricing guide to decide how much the car is truly worth. 
  6. You can also check out the vehicle history report by getting the vehicle’s identification number from the owner. 
  7. Before you see the car, ask the owner any questions you may have. The answers to these questions might save you time from going out and seeing the vehicle. 
  8. Go on a test drive, carefully looking at the interior of the vehicle for any signs of wear and tear. Make sure the radio works, along with the A/C and heating system.
